PARIS (AP) — A suspect threw an incendiary device that exploded outside the Russian Consulate in Marseille early Monday, authorities said, on the third anniversary of Russia’s invasion of Ukraine. No injuries were reported.

The French soccer league has given Marseille president Pablo Longoria a 15-match ban after he accused French referees of corruption following a defeat last Saturday.
Neil El Aynaoui’s last-gasp winner rejuvenated Lens’ European push as they beat Marseille 1-0 at the Stade Vélodrome, ending L’OM’s seven-game unbeaten Ligue 1 run in the process.
